Marrero, LA: June 2008 Home Sales and Real Estate Market Reports

Marrero LA Homes for Sale as of 7/2/2008

  • 275 active listings, priced from $64,000 to $1,600,000
  • 14 pending (offer accepted but still showing) listings, priced from $114,900 to $249,900
  • 1 open predication offer, priced at $165,000
  • 50 under contract listings, priced from $54,900 to $357,400
  • Based on June 2008 sales, there is a 9.8 month supply of homes for sale in Marrero, still above the 5-6 month supply of a balanced real estate market and indicating that Marrero represents some great opportunities for qualified buyers.

 

Marrero, LA Home Sales - January 2008 through June 2008

Marrero number sold June

 

  • 28 homes were sold in Marrero in June 2008, compared to 35 sold in May
  • Days on market for June ranged from 3 to 342, with an average of 99
  • Marrero home sales in the 2nd quarter of 2008 were down slightly from the 1st quarter

Marrero LA Average Home Sale Prices - January 2008 through June 2008

Marrero avg sale June

 

  • The average Marrero home sale price in June 2008 was $170,633, up significantly from May.  However, May appears to have been a blip in sales as evidenced by the chart above.
  • The average listing price in Marrero is $189,768, still well above the average sales for the last 6 months in the area.  Sellers need to review their pricing and condition to be sure that they are as competitive as possible since it is still a buyer’s market in Marrero at this time.
  • 2nd quarter average sale prices were up from the 1st quarter, but again, this can be attributed to the low sales prices seen in May 2008.

Marrero, LA: June 2008 Real Estate Absorption Rates

Here is a quick look at the current real estate market in Marrero, LA.

  • A balanced real estate market has on average a 5-6 month supply of homes for sale.  Typically, over 6 months of inventory indicates a buyers market.
  • Homes priced under $160,000 are continuing to sell very well in Marrero, since this is the lower end of the market in a demand area of the West Bank
  • The overall supply of homes for sale in Marrero dropped from 8.1 in May to the current 7.5 months of inventory, the lowest across the West Bank
  • Highlighted price ranges show categories that fall into or right above a balanced/seller’s market at this time.  Home owners in the $225,000 to $250,000 may want to consider a price adjustment given the large amount of competition and the small number of homes being sold in that range.

Real Estate Absorption Rates for Marrero, LA as of 6/18/2008

 

 

 

Remember, an absorption report is a snapshot of the market at the current time, and the statistical odds of selling in 90 days will vary depending on the number of homes for sale and recent closed sales.  This is not a guarantee that your home will sell within this timeframe, only a tool to use to gauge buyer interest in the various price ranges in the area.

Marrero, LA: May 2008 Home Sales and Real Estate Market Report

May 2008 Home Sales in Marrero, LA

 

  • 265 homes currently listed for sale in Marrero, LA
  • 69 homes are under contract or pending sale, priced from $45,000 to $395,000
  • 35 homes sold in May 2008, compared to 26 in April 2008

 

 

  • The average home sale price in Marrero for May 2008 was $149,152, down from $165,776 in April
  • The year to date average home sale price in Marrero is $157,971
  • The average listing price in Marrero is $187,726
  • The average days on market for Marrero homes sold in May was 79, right at the 2008 year to date average

Marrero, LA: May 2008 Real Estate Absorption Report

The overall supply of homes for sale in Marrero has decreased slightly from the 8.3 months observed in April to the current 8.1 month supply.  Keep in mind that a balanced real estate market has a 5-6 month supply of homes for sale…more than that indicates a buyers market for the area.

 

Homes priced in the under $160,000 range are selling very well and sellers in this price range can feel fairly comfortable that they can sell their homes in a relatively short period of time.  The $100,000-$140,000 range has slowed slightly, but is still performing.  The number of homes listed for sale has remained steady with 5 fewer listings than we saw at this time last month. 

 

The $160,000-$200,000 range accounts for 41% of the current listings but only 24% of the recent sales.  Sellers in this price range need to not only be aggressive in pricing their homes, they also need to remember to make them "show ready" at all times.  Buyers have a large number of choices and are opting for those homes that they perceive to be the best value in their price range.  Also, sellers should remain open to negotiating closing cost assistance to buyers, who are no longer able to get 100% financing.  More and more often, I’m seeing these assistance requests on mid-range priced homes since buyers are having to come up with more down payment funds.

Marrero, LA: April 2008 Home Sales and Real Estate Market Report

The Marrero real estate market slowed in April 2008, with 26 homes sold compared to 39 in March.  The number of active listings was steady, showing a slight reduction from the 265 listed just one month ago.   Based on the April sales, there is a 13.9 month supply of homes for sale in Marrero, definitely a buyer’s market overall.

 

  • Active listings:  259
  • Average list price:  $191,919
  • Pending but continue to show listings:  11  (Average list price $121,773)
  • Open predication listings:  2  (Average list price $252,500)
  • Under contract listings:  56  (Average list price $167,293)

 

 

Marrero Home Sales for April 2008

 

70072  units sold

 

 

Marrero Average Home Sales Prices for April 2008

 

Despite the reduction in the number of homes sold in April, the average sale price showed another increase, ending the month at $165,776 - the highest yet for 2008 and higher than the same period last year.
